Corruption and Scandals in Grant's Administration
This chapter explores the corruption and scandals surrounding President Grant's re-election campaign, including the Credit Mobilier scandal and economic crisis triggered by the collapse of Jay Cook and Company. It discusses the implications of these scandals on the U.S. government and public perception of government corruption.
